Gas Water Heater Repair in Denver, CO
Gas water heater repair services address issues related to the functionality and efficiency of gas-powered water heating systems commonly found in homes. These projects typically involve diagnosing problems such as inconsistent hot water supply, strange noises, pilot light failures, or leaks. Repairs may include replacing faulty thermocouples, repairing or replacing gas valves, fixing ignition systems, or addressing corrosion and sediment buildup that can impair performance. Property owners should understand the specific symptoms their water heater exhibits and whether it is a traditional tank model or a tankless system, as this information helps determine the appropriate repair approach.
Before requesting gas water heater repair, homeowners often want to know about the scope of work involved, the potential costs, and the expected outcomes. It is useful to understand the age of the unit, as older systems may require more extensive repairs or replacement considerations. Additionally, property owners should be aware of safety precautions, such as turning off the gas supply before work begins, and inquire about the technician’s experience with their specific type of water heater. Clear communication about the problem symptoms and maintenance history can help facilitate efficient repairs and ensure the system operates safely and effectively afterward.

Common Gas Water Heater Repair Jobs
Gas water heater repair involves fixing issues that cause insufficient hot water or system leaks.
Thermostat problems can prevent the water from reaching the desired temperature.
Ignition or pilot light issues may cause the heater to fail to operate properly.
Corrosion or sediment buildup can lead to inefficiency and potential damage.
Leak repairs address drips or pooling caused by faulty valves or tank cracks.
System replacements are recommended when repairs are no longer effective or cost-efficient.
Gas Water Heater Repair Questions
What are common signs of a malfunctioning gas water heater? Signs include inconsistent hot water, strange noises, or a lack of hot water during use.
Can a gas water heater be repaired if it’s leaking? Yes, leaks can often be repaired by replacing faulty valves, fittings, or damaged tanks.
What causes a gas water heater to stop producing hot water? Causes may include a faulty thermocouple, pilot light issues, or sediment buildup inside the tank.
Is it necessary to replace a gas water heater that’s old or inefficient? Replacement may be recommended if the unit is outdated, frequently needs repairs, or isn’t operating efficiently.
